软件定义网络中异构通信系统资源调度算法研究

Research on Resource Scheduling Algorithms for Heterogeneous Communication Systems in Software-defined Networks

摘要

Abstract

Software-defined network provides a new implementation scheme for heterogeneous wireless network resource scheduling by separating control plane from data plane.Global resource scheduling algorithm based on SDN architecture,local resource scheduling algorithm and dynamic scheduling algorithm based on network state are researched and designed,and multi-layer heterogeneous network simulation environment is constructed for performance verification.The experimental results show that in the network congestion scenario,the response time of dynamic scheduling algorithm to the change of network state is reduced by 42%,the resource utilization efficiency is increased by 35%,and the dynamic scheduling algorithm has obvious advantages in the burst service processing.Multi-dimensional data analysis verifies the feasibility and advancement of this algorithm in SDN environment.
